Grand Junction hadn't done well against Horizon recently (they were 0-6 in their previous six matchups), but they didn't let the past get in their way on Friday. The Tigers came out on top against the Hawks by a score of 70-59. For the Tigers, this counts as revenge for the 66-64 victory the Hawks walked away with the last time they faced one another back in December of 2024.

Grand Junction's success was the result of a balanced attack that saw several players step up, but Noah Schmalz led the charge by going 7-for-8 en route to 20 points. Will Weirath was another key player, shooting 57% from the field to rack up 21 points.

Grand Junction has started the season off flawlessly and has a 2-0 record to show for it. The wins came thanks in part to their offensive performance across that stretch, as they've averaged 71.0 points this season. As for Horizon, their loss dropped their record down to 0-2.

Grand Junction has already played their next contest, a 60-36 victory against Pueblo Central on the 6th. As for Horizon, they also wasted no time getting back out on the court and have already played their next matchup, a 60-46 win against Grand Junction Central on the 6th.
